Expense Approval Reports
Expense approval reports in EquiBillBook track the approval status of expenses, monitor approval workflows, and help manage expense approvals efficiently. This guide explains how to generate and use expense approval reports.
What are Expense Approval Reports?
Expense approval reports provide information about:
- Expenses pending approval
- Approved expenses
- Rejected expenses
- Approval history and status
- Approval turnaround times
- Expenses by approver
Accessing Approval Reports
To generate expense approval reports:
- Navigate to Expense Reports or Reports → Expense Reports
- Select "Expense Approval Reports" or "Approval Status Report"
- Configure report parameters
- Click "Generate Report"
Report Parameters
Configure the following parameters:
- Date Range: Select the period for analysis
- Approval Status: Filter by status (Pending, Approved, Rejected, All)
- Approver: Filter by specific approver (if multiple approvers)
- Business Location: Filter by branch/location (optional)
- Category: Filter by expense category (optional)
- User/Employee: Filter by expense creator (optional)
Types of Approval Reports
1. Pending Approvals Report
Shows expenses awaiting approval:
- List of expenses pending approval
- Submission dates
- Days pending approval
- Assigned approvers
- Expense amounts and details
2. Approved Expenses Report
Shows expenses that have been approved:
- List of approved expenses
- Approval dates
- Approver information
- Approval turnaround time
- Expense details
3. Rejected Expenses Report
Shows expenses that were rejected:
- List of rejected expenses
- Rejection dates
- Rejection reasons
- Rejected by (approver)
- Resubmission status (if applicable)
4. Approval Summary Report
Provides overview of approval activity:
- Total expenses by status
- Approval rates
- Average approval times
- Rejection rates
- Statistics by approver
